Craig Shearer Testmonial - RCFC 31st Aug

The Craig Shearer Testimonial football match opposition has been confirmed as Ross County FC.

The match will be played on Tuesday 31st August at the Harmsworth Park, Wick with a 7.30pm kick off.

The Craig Shearer Testmonial Committee are grateful to Ross County FC for agreeing to support this fixture and are equally excited by the prospect of welcoming a squad which is expected to include many of the players who were involved in last seasons Scottish Cup Final.

Alistair Ross said "Following the disappointment of realising the financial implications of bringing Dunfermline Athletic FC to Wick, we are very excited at the prospect of welcoming Ross County FC to the Harmsworth Park. We would like to thank them for agreeing to participate in the testimonial fixture in recognition of Craig. I know he is very excited about the fixture and we hope that his contribution to Wick Academy FC over the past 11 years will be recognised by the supporters."

"With such a tough opposition, we are hopeful that a good showing is enjoyed by all on the night, not least Craig and his family."

Thurso 2 - WAFC 2

Thurso gave Academy a really good pre-season run-out today. Thurso took the lead after 13 minutes, Jamie Mackenzie won the ball in the middle of the park and drove down the left, his cut back found the unmarked Mark Nicol and his low effort found the bottom corner from 15 yards
Within a minute wick nearly got back on level terms, Sam Mackay played a long ball out to Craig Shearer and he put the ball into the box to Richard Macadie and his driven effort was blocked by Michael Gray in the Thurso goal.

Wick got back on level terms after 23 minutes, Davie Allan was played in one on one with keeper Gray, Gray took Allan down and Sam Mackay took the penalty and drove the ball down the middle.

Wick went ahead after 36 minutes Davie Allan was tackled on the edge of the box but the ball fell kindly to his brother Ross Allan, he cut inside onto his left before dispatching a low effort into the corner of the net.

Half Time Thurso 1 Wick Academy 2


After 57 minutes wick really should have added a third, Ross Allan played a neat one two with Sam Mackay,  Allan then found Gary Weir, Weir had time to steady himself and pick his spot but he curled the ball wide of the post

On the hour mark Kyle Ross set up James Murray for a chance for Thurso but from 25 yards he screwed his shot wide.

Thurso got back on level terms after 86 minutes, Gary Manson appeared to handle the ball on the line after a corner and this resulted in the ref awarding a penalty, Mark Nicol stepped up and coolly placed the ball low to the keepers right

Full Time Thurso 2 Wick Academy 2
